About The Role

Sutton Real Estate Company is seeking a Property Superintendent to be is responsible for the day-to-day maintenance, appearance, safety, and overall physical condition of properties managed by the real estate firm. This position serves as a hands-on representative of the company and works closely with property management, tenants, vendors, contractors, and service providers to ensure properties are well maintained, safe, clean, and operating efficiently.

The ideal candidate is dependable, mechanically inclined, organized, customer-service oriented, and comfortable working independently while managing multiple priorities.

Property Maintenance & Operations

  • Conduct routine inspections of assigned properties and identify maintenance, repair, safety, and cleanliness concerns.
  • Perform general building maintenance and minor repairs, including basic plumbing, electrical, carpentry, painting, drywall, doors, locks, fixtures, and other building components.
  • Maintain common areas, entrances, hallways, grounds, mechanical areas, and other property spaces in a clean, orderly, and presentable condition.
  • Monitor building systems and equipment and report issues requiring specialized service or major repair.
  • Respond promptly to maintenance requests, emergencies, and urgent property concerns.
  • Coordinate and/or perform seasonal property maintenance, including snow removal, ice management, landscaping, and other weather-related needs.
  • Maintain appropriate inventory of maintenance supplies, tools, and equipment.
  • Assist with preparation of vacant units or spaces for new tenants, including cleaning, repairs, touch-ups, and general turnover work.
